My 1st gen 84 rx7(pretty much worn out 180,000+ miles) will sometimes get a large burst of power and the throttle will stick wide open for a few seconds if I rev it over 4000rpm. Just wanted to know if anyone has any knowledge of this problem

j9fd3s 04-14-2003 11:58 AM

there is a thing on the back of the carby that, is like an over center springy thing. it likes to pop off. you have to pull the spring up and put it over the lever. i hope someone has a picture its a lot easier that way
